Patents by Inventor Thomas Page

Thomas Page has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11643885
    Abstract: A tubular gripping apparatus includes a housing having a bore and a plurality of gripping members movable between a gripping position and a release position. The apparatus may also include a shield having a tubular inner body movable relative to an outer body. The tubular inner body is movable between a retracted position, in which the tubular inner body is positioned above the plurality of gripping members, and an extended position, in which the inner body is at least partially positioned interiorly of the plurality of gripping members.
    Type: Grant
    Filed: March 29, 2021
    Date of Patent: May 9, 2023
    Assignee: WEATHERFORD TECHNOLOGY HOLDINGS, LLC
    Inventors: Ruben Gomez, Kevin Thomas Page
  • Patent number: 11515705
    Abstract: The present disclosure provides a new and improved method and apparatus of scheduling for a charging infrastructure serving a plurality of electric vehicles. A computer-implemented method for scheduling a charging infrastructure serving a plurality of electric vehicles is provided, in which a prediction for a usage pattern of the charging infrastructure is made with a context based on historical usage patterns of the charging infrastructure and the contexts of the historical usage patterns, and a schedule scheme for deciding a distribution of charging spots of the charging infrastructure among the electric vehicles is determined based on the predicted usage pattern.
    Type: Grant
    Filed: November 15, 2019
    Date of Patent: November 29, 2022
    Assignee: Bayerische Motoren Werke Aktiengesellschaft
    Inventors: Bo Liu, Thomas Page, Qiao Ding, Qing Yang, Christoph Tomoki Hein, Stefan Groesbrink
  • Publication number: 20220307333
    Abstract: A tubular gripping apparatus includes a housing having a bore and a plurality of gripping members movable between a gripping position and a release position. The apparatus may also include a shield having a tubular inner body movable relative to an outer body. The tubular inner body is movable between a retracted position, in which the tubular inner body is positioned above the plurality of gripping members, and an extended position, in which the inner body is at least partially positioned interiorly of the plurality of gripping members.
    Type: Application
    Filed: March 29, 2021
    Publication date: September 29, 2022
    Inventors: Ruben GOMEZ, Kevin Thomas PAGE
  • Patent number: 11249823
    Abstract: Method and systems for facilitating communications using application programming interfaces (“APIs”) by interpreting a received command based on the command and an image of the user interface that was displayed on a display screen when the command was received.
    Type: Grant
    Filed: June 4, 2019
    Date of Patent: February 15, 2022
    Assignee: Rovi Guides, Inc.
    Inventors: Manik Malhotra, Jon Wayne Heim, Thomas Page Odom
  • Patent number: 11018464
    Abstract: An RF signal processing system including multiple drop-in modular circuit blocks is disclosed. The drop-in modular circuit blocks include input and output launches exhibiting the same launch geometry. The RF system may include a conductive plate with a grid of holes disposed on the conductive plate. Multiple modular blocks may be installed on the conductive plate to form a cascade of modular blocks that exhibit common launch geometries. The cascade may include an RF probe with a projection and conductive pin that overhang a portion of a launch of a modular block at an end of the cascade. Flex connects may be disposed on, and held in position by, anchors to connect adjacent modular blocks together in a prototype system. A production RF system may exhibit the same overall geometry as a prototype RF system to speed up the transition from prototype design to production design.
    Type: Grant
    Filed: January 31, 2019
    Date of Patent: May 25, 2021
    Assignee: X-Microwave, LLC
    Inventors: John Dale Richardson, Raymond Thomas Page
  • Patent number: 10990456
    Abstract: Method and systems for facilitating communications using application programming interfaces (“APIs”) by interpreting a received command based on the command and an image of the user interface that was displayed on a display screen when the command was received.
    Type: Grant
    Filed: June 4, 2019
    Date of Patent: April 27, 2021
    Assignee: ROVI GUIDE, INC.
    Inventors: Manik Malhotra, Jon Wayne Heim, Thomas Page Odom
  • Patent number: 10901946
    Abstract: A graphical user interface can be generated on a display by a processor. The graphical user interface can be rendered, on a display, with a first circular representation of a directory structure of a first directory of an electronic content management system. The first circular representation can have a hierarchy of levels representative of a hierarchy within the first directory. The first circular representation can be rendered in a display that displays the graphical user interface. A second circular representation of a second directory within the first directory can be generated. The second circular representation of the second directory can have a hierarchy of levels representative of a hierarchy within the second directory. The second circular representation of the second directory can be generated in response to a user input selecting the second directory.
    Type: Grant
    Filed: November 11, 2016
    Date of Patent: January 26, 2021
    Inventor: Thomas Page
  • Publication number: 20200387413
    Abstract: Method and systems for facilitating communications using application programming interfaces (“APIs”) by interpreting a received command based on the command and an image of the user interface that was displayed on a display screen when the command was received.
    Type: Application
    Filed: June 4, 2019
    Publication date: December 10, 2020
    Inventors: Manik Malhotra, Jon Wayne Heim, Thomas Page Odom
  • Publication number: 20200387414
    Abstract: Method and systems for facilitating communications using application programming interfaces (“APIs”) by interpreting a received command based on the command and an image of the user interface that was displayed on a display screen when the command was received.
    Type: Application
    Filed: June 4, 2019
    Publication date: December 10, 2020
    Inventors: Manik Malhotra, Jon Wayne Heim, Thomas Page Odom
  • Patent number: 10784633
    Abstract: An RF signal processing system including multiple drop-in modular circuit blocks is disclosed. The drop-in modular circuit blocks include input and output launches exhibiting the same launch geometry. The RF system may include a conductive plate with a grid of holes disposed on the conductive plate. Multiple modular blocks may be installed on the conductive plate to form a cascade of modular blocks that exhibit common launch geometries. The cascade may include an RF probe with a projection and conductive pin that overhang a portion of a launch of a modular block at an end of the cascade. Flex connects may be disposed on, and held in position by, anchors to connect adjacent modular blocks together in a prototype system. A production RF system may exhibit the same overall geometry as a prototype RF system to speed up the transition from prototype design to production design.
    Type: Grant
    Filed: January 31, 2019
    Date of Patent: September 22, 2020
    Assignee: X-MICROWAVE, LLC
    Inventors: John Dale Richardson, Raymond Thomas Page
  • Publication number: 20200082352
    Abstract: The present disclosure provides a new and improved method and apparatus of scheduling for a charging infrastructure serving a plurality of electric vehicles. A computer-implemented method for scheduling a charging infrastructure serving a plurality of electric vehicles is provided, in which a prediction for a usage pattern of the charging infrastructure is made with a context based on historical usage patterns of the charging infrastructure and the contexts of the historical usage patterns, and a schedule scheme for deciding a distribution of charging spots of the charging infrastructure among the electric vehicles is determined based on the predicted usage pattern.
    Type: Application
    Filed: November 15, 2019
    Publication date: March 12, 2020
    Inventors: Bo LIU, Thomas PAGE, Qiao DING, Qing YANG, Christoph Tomoki HEIN, Stefan GROESBRINK
  • Publication number: 20190173244
    Abstract: An RF signal processing system including multiple drop-in modular circuit blocks is disclosed. The drop-in modular circuit blocks include input and output launches exhibiting the same launch geometry. The RF system may include a conductive plate with a grid of holes disposed on the conductive plate. Multiple modular blocks may be installed on the conductive plate to form a cascade of modular blocks that exhibit common launch geometries. The cascade may include an RF probe with a projection and conductive pin that overhang a portion of a launch of a modular block at an end of the cascade. Flex connects may be disposed on, and held in position by, anchors to connect adjacent modular blocks together in a prototype system. A production RF system may exhibit the same overall geometry as a prototype RF system to speed up the transition from prototype design to production design.
    Type: Application
    Filed: January 31, 2019
    Publication date: June 6, 2019
    Applicant: X-MICROWAVE, LLC
    Inventors: John Dale Richardson, Raymond Thomas Page
  • Publication number: 20190165522
    Abstract: An RF signal processing system including multiple drop-in modular circuit blocks is disclosed. The drop-in modular circuit blocks include input and output launches exhibiting the same launch geometry. The RF system may include a conductive plate with a grid of holes disposed on the conductive plate. Multiple modular blocks may be installed on the conductive plate to form a cascade of modular blocks that exhibit common launch geometries. The cascade may include an RF probe with a projection and conductive pin that overhang a portion of a launch of a modular block at an end of the cascade. Flex connects may be disposed on, and held in position by, anchors to connect adjacent modular blocks together in a prototype system. A production RF system may exhibit the same overall geometry as a prototype RF system to speed up the transition from prototype design to production design.
    Type: Application
    Filed: January 31, 2019
    Publication date: May 30, 2019
    Applicant: X-MICROWAVE, LLC
    Inventors: John Dale Richardson, Raymond Thomas Page
  • Publication number: 20190165521
    Abstract: An RF signal processing system including multiple drop-in modular circuit blocks is disclosed. The drop-in modular circuit blocks include input and output launches exhibiting the same launch geometry. The RF system may include a conductive plate with a grid of holes disposed on the conductive plate. Multiple modular blocks may be installed on the conductive plate to form a cascade of modular blocks that exhibit common launch geometries. The cascade may include an RF probe with a projection and conductive pin that overhang a portion of a launch of a modular block at an end of the cascade. Flex connects may be disposed on, and held in position by, anchors to connect adjacent modular blocks together in a prototype system. A production RF system may exhibit the same overall geometry as a prototype RF system to speed up the transition from prototype design to production design.
    Type: Application
    Filed: January 31, 2019
    Publication date: May 30, 2019
    Applicant: X-MICROWAVE, LLC
    Inventors: John Dale Richardson, Raymond Thomas Page
  • Publication number: 20190165523
    Abstract: An RF signal processing system including multiple drop-in modular circuit blocks is disclosed. The drop-in modular circuit blocks include input and output launches exhibiting the same launch geometry. The RF system may include a conductive plate with a grid of holes disposed on the conductive plate. Multiple modular blocks may be installed on the conductive plate to form a cascade of modular blocks that exhibit common launch geometries. The cascade may include an RF probe with a projection and conductive pin that overhang a portion of a launch of a modular block at an end of the cascade. Flex connects may be disposed on, and held in position by, anchors to connect adjacent modular blocks together in a prototype system. A production RF system may exhibit the same overall geometry as a prototype RF system to speed up the transition from prototype design to production design.
    Type: Application
    Filed: January 31, 2019
    Publication date: May 30, 2019
    Applicant: X-MICROWAVE, LLC
    Inventors: John Dale Richardson, Raymond Thomas Page
  • Patent number: 10230202
    Abstract: An RF signal processing system including multiple drop-in modular circuit blocks is disclosed. The drop-in modular circuit blocks include input and output launches exhibiting the same launch geometry. The RF system may include a conductive plate with a grid of holes disposed on the conductive plate. Multiple modular blocks may be installed on the conductive plate to form a cascade of modular blocks that exhibit common launch geometries. The cascade may include an RF probe with a projection and conductive pin that overhang a portion of a launch of a modular block at an end of the cascade. Flex connects may be disposed on, and held in position by, anchors to connect adjacent modular blocks together in a prototype system. A production RF system may exhibit the same overall geometry as a prototype RF system to speed up the transition from prototype design to production design.
    Type: Grant
    Filed: November 4, 2015
    Date of Patent: March 12, 2019
    Assignee: X-MICROWAVE, LLC
    Inventors: John Dale Richardson, Raymond Thomas Page
  • Publication number: 20180137138
    Abstract: A graphical user interface can be generated on a display by a processor. The graphical user interface can be rendered, on a display, with a first circular representation of a directory structure of a first directory of an electronic content management system. The first circular representation can have a hierarchy of levels representative of a hierarchy within the first directory. The first circular representation can be rendered in a display that displays the graphical user interface. A second circular representation of a second directory within the first directory can be generated. The second circular representation of the second directory can have a hierarchy of levels representative of a hierarchy within the second directory. The second circular representation of the second directory can be generated in response to a user input selecting the second directory.
    Type: Application
    Filed: November 11, 2016
    Publication date: May 17, 2018
    Inventor: Thomas Page
  • Patent number: 9443733
    Abstract: The present disclosure describes apparatuses and techniques for device-based die authentication. In some aspects, an intensity of a particle beam is varied during semiconductor processing to provide a semiconductor die having devices of varied values. In other aspects, different areas of semiconductor dies are exposed during semiconductor processing to provide semiconductor dies with devices that vary in value from one die to the next. For each semiconductor die, a value generated based on the values of the die's respective devices can be associated with that die thereby enabling subsequent authentication of the semiconductor die.
    Type: Grant
    Filed: October 30, 2014
    Date of Patent: September 13, 2016
    Assignee: Marvell World Trade Ltd.
    Inventors: Patrick A. McKinley, Walter Lee McNall, Robert W. Shreeve, Thomas Page Bruch, Neal C. Jaarsma
  • Publication number: 20150123702
    Abstract: The present disclosure describes apparatuses and techniques for device-based die authentication. In some aspects, an intensity of a particle beam is varied during semiconductor processing to provide a semiconductor die having devices of varied values. In other aspects, different areas of semiconductor dies are exposed during semiconductor processing to provide semiconductor dies with devices that vary in value from one die to the next. For each semiconductor die, a value generated based on the values of the die's respective devices can be associated with that die thereby enabling subsequent authentication of the semiconductor die.
    Type: Application
    Filed: October 30, 2014
    Publication date: May 7, 2015
    Inventors: Patrick A. McKinley, Walter Lee McNall, Robert W. Shreeve, Thomas Page Bruch, Neal C. Jaarsma
  • Patent number: 8191033
    Abstract: Embodiments of the present invention provide a method/apparatus to measure the jitter of a timing signal used in an integrated circuit chip. The method/apparatus is used to send data from a launch element using a synchronous data path of the timing signal, receive the data at a capture element using the synchronous data path, wherein the launch element and the capture element are disposed on the same integrated circuit chip upon which the timing signal is generated and/or used, and gather statistics about whether a timing violation has occurred by comparing the sent data with the received data over the course of multiple launch/capture events as the timing is adjusted. Other embodiments may be described and/or claimed.
    Type: Grant
    Filed: November 6, 2009
    Date of Patent: May 29, 2012
    Assignee: Marvell International Ltd.
    Inventor: Thomas Page Bruch